Subject: Re: [PATCH v9 1/8] lib/cmdline.c: remove quotes symmetrically
Date: Fri, 15 Dec 2017 21:51:21 +0100 [thread overview]
Message-ID: <20171215215121.0560e669@kitsune.suse.cz>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<151075900967.14434.2860376398321506569.stgit@hbathini.in.ibm.com>
On Wed, 15 Nov 2017 20:46:56 +0530
Hari Bathini <hbathini@linux.vnet.ibm.com> wrote:
> From: Michal Suchanek <msuchanek@suse.de>
>
> Remove quotes from argument value only if there is qoute on both
> sides.
>
> Signed-off-by: Michal Suchanek <msuchanek@suse.de>
> ---
> lib/cmdline.c | 10 ++++------
> 1 file changed, 4 insertions(+), 6 deletions(-)
>
> diff --git a/lib/cmdline.c b/lib/cmdline.c
> index 171c19b..6d398a8 100644
> --- a/lib/cmdline.c
> +++ b/lib/cmdline.c
> @@ -227,14 +227,12 @@ char *next_arg(char *args, char **param, char
> **val) *val = args + equals + 1;
>
> /* Don't include quotes in value. */
> - if (**val == '"') {
> - (*val)++;
> - if (args[i-1] == '"')
> - args[i-1] = '\0';
> + if ((args[i-1] == '"') && ((quoted) || (**val ==
> '"'))) {
> + args[i-1] = '\0';
> + if (!quoted)
> + (*val)++;
> }
> }
> - if (quoted && args[i-1] == '"')
> - args[i-1] = '\0';
>
> if (args[i]) {
> args[i] = '\0';
>
This was only useful as separate patch with the incremental fadump
update. Since the fadump update is squashed in this refresh series this
can be squashed with the following lib/cmdline patch as well.
Thanks
Michal
